U.S. Consumption Prices Surpassed Expectations

Image Source: Pexels
 

  • US personal consumption expenditure prices in April surpassed expectations bolstering confidence in the Federal Reserve’s commitment to a hawkish stance and prolonged elevated interest rates.
  • Core PCE, which excludes food and energy, experienced a 0.4% month-over-month increase in April 2023, surpassing market expectations of a 0.3% gain.
  • The annual rate of core PCE, a key inflation metric favored by the Federal Reserve, unexpectedly accelerated to 4.7%, exceeding market expectations of 4.6%.
  • The headline PCE also rose by 0.4% in April and registered a year-on-year increase of 4.4%, surpassing the 4.2% rate observed in March.

Note: The term "month-over-month" means comparing data from one month to the previous month, while "year-on-year" refers to comparing data from the same month in the previous year.

The elevated inflation reading has the potential to prompt the US Federal Reserve to maintain its current terminal rate, which could be perceived by investors as a hawkish stance and bearish for equities. The market’s reaction will largely depend on the outcome of forthcoming economic data releases in the coming week.

Furthermore, the data-driven support for the dollar may exert downward pressure on commodities such as Copper or Gold. Conversely, Crude oil could experience a positive effect from a stronger dollar, as the United States has emerged as a significant oil exporter. Increased trade activity could lead to greater demand for the dollar, bolstering its value and supporting currency appreciation as well.
